Compartilhar via


OracleCommand.Connection Propriedade

Definição

Obtém ou define o OracleConnection usado por essa instância do OracleCommand.

public:
 property System::Data::OracleClient::OracleConnection ^ Connection { System::Data::OracleClient::OracleConnection ^ get(); void set(System::Data::OracleClient::OracleConnection ^ value); };
public System.Data.OracleClient.OracleConnection Connection { get; set; }
member this.Connection : System.Data.OracleClient.OracleConnection with get, set
Public Property Connection As OracleConnection

Valor da propriedade

A conexão com uma fonte de dados. O padrão é um valor null.

Exceções

A propriedade Connection foi alterada enquanto uma transação estava em andamento.

Exemplos

O exemplo a seguir cria um OracleCommand e define algumas de suas propriedades.

public void CreateOracleCommand()
{
   string queryString = "SELECT * FROM Emp ORDER BY EmpNo";
   OracleCommand command = new OracleCommand(queryString);
   command.CommandType = CommandType.Text;
}
Public Sub CreateOracleCommand()
    Dim queryString As String = _
       "SELECT * FROM Emp ORDER BY EmpNo"
    Dim command As New OracleCommand(queryString)
    command.CommandType = CommandType.Text
End Sub

Comentários

Você não poderá definir as Connectionpropriedades , CommandTypee CommandText se a conexão atual estiver executando uma operação de execução ou busca.

Se você definir Connection enquanto uma transação estiver em andamento e a Transaction propriedade não for nula, um InvalidOperationException será gerado. Se você definir Connection depois que a transação tiver sido confirmada ou revertida e a Transaction propriedade não for nula, a Transaction propriedade será definida como um valor nulo.

Aplica-se a

Confira também